(define-public soxr
  (package
    (name "soxr")
    (version "0.1.1")
    (source
     (origin
       (method url-fetch)
       (uri
        (string-append "mirror://sourceforge/soxr/soxr-" version
                       "-Source.tar.xz"))
       (sha256
        (base32 "1hmadwqfpg15vhwq9pa1sl5xslibrjpk6hpq2s9hfmx1s5l6ihfw"))))
    (build-system cmake-build-system)
    (arguments '(#:tests? #f))          ;no 'check' target
    (home-page "http://sourceforge.net/p/soxr/wiki/Home/")
    (synopsis "One-dimensional sample-rate conversion library")
    (description
     "The SoX Resampler library (libsoxr) performs one-dimensional sample-rate
conversion.  It may be used, for example, to resample PCM-encoded audio.")
    (license license:lgpl2.1+)))
